Ticket: QP-rollback signature check failing on Pinwheel 4.2.1

Hey — quick heads up before you cut the release. The hotfix for the query planner regression (the one where Pinwheel started full-scanning the orders table after the stats refresh) is ready, but the artifact keeps failing signature verification on the staging promoter. Turns out the build box was still signing with the key we retired last sprint. Rebuilt and re-signed, verification passes locally now. For the promotion job, use the current release key, pasted below.

rollout seal: bky4_DFM9

## Changelog — Spandiff v1.9.0

This release improves Spandiff's handling of files over 500 MB. Chunked hunk loading replaces the full in-memory parse, reducing peak memory by roughly 60% on the Greywall benchmark set. Syntax highlighting is now deferred until a hunk scrolls into view. Release managers should verify the rollback path before promoting, and direct any regressions to the owner listed below.

approver of bagug-bagag = Holael Pramir

The experiment branch diverged from mainline before the rounding-rule refactor, so results must not be compared against post-refactor baselines. All artifacts were produced by the hermetic pipeline with pinned toolchain versions, and the experiment config was frozen at cutover. Future maintainers should verify the config hash before rerunning any cohort analysis. The exact build used in production cohorts is recorded below.

pipeline stamp: htk4_ae36

Subject: Rotation — Parityscope checker key

On-call,

The Parityscope rate-parity checker got a new credential tonight. Old key dies at 02:00 UTC. If the hourly scrape against the Bellhaven rate feed starts returning 401s, restart the worker pool after updating the env var — it caches credentials at boot. Alerts route to the usual channel. No other config changes. Use the key below.

— Teodor

service key, kaduf-bawig: kto15_Ze79S0dligTw0yO